在 Web 应用程序中使用 Kendo UI 开关

Posted

技术标签:

【中文标题】在 Web 应用程序中使用 Kendo UI 开关【英文标题】:Use Kendo UI switch in a web application 【发布时间】:2014-09-19 21:50:34 【问题描述】:

我正在尝试使用 Kendo 移动小部件 - 在我的 Web 应用程序中切换如下:

<input id="btnConvert" type="checkbox" onclick="onChange();" />

 $(document).ready()
            
        $("#btnConvert").kendoMobileSwitch(
            onLabel: "UK",
            offLabel: "US"
        );        
    
    function onChange(e) 
        alert(e.checked);//true of false
    

但它没有触发点击事件。我尝试了同样不起作用的 onchange 事件。

我也试过了

    $('input:checkbox').change(function () 

但没有成功...

【问题讨论】:

【参考方案1】:

switch 定义中定义一个change 处理程序事件。

$("#btnConvert").kendoMobileSwitch(
    onLabel: "UK",
    offLabel: "US",
    change : function (e) 
        alert("You changed the value");
    
); 

请参阅文档here。

【讨论】:

您好 OnaBai,非常感谢您的回答。我关注了你的许多答案,而且你的名字在 *** 上很受欢迎...... 我几周前发布了另一个未解之谜:***.com/questions/24166750/…,我还没有找到解决方案... 你能在 JSFiddle 中重现它吗?似乎与事情发生的顺序有关(第一次绘图和容器大小)

以上是关于在 Web 应用程序中使用 Kendo UI 开关的主要内容,如果未能解决你的问题,请参考以下文章

关于Kendo UI 开发教程

Kendo UI for jQuery使用教程:支持Web浏览器

Kendo Ui web 复选框数据绑定

Kendo UI Web 和 Kendo UI ASP.NET for MVC 之间的区别

构建的Web应用界面不够好看?快试试最新的Kendo UI R3 2019

开发的Web应用界面太难看?Kendo UI R1 2020工具全新发布帮你忙